Outline of Final Research Achievements

This study shows antifibrotic effects of bFGF injection in hypertensive DS rat hearts carried out using cardiac fibroblast lines harvested from the heart during the LV dilation phase. Specifically, we demonstrated that (1) bFGF inhibited interstitial fibrosis in hypertensive rat heart in vivo; (2) bFGF up-regulated TIMP-1 and down- regulated MMP-9 expression in cardiac fibroblasts (CFs) from hypertensive rat hearts; (3) bFGF also inhibited the expression of collagen I and III in the CFs; (4) real-time PCR array microRNA assays in bFGF treated CFs identified several microRNAs that were up-regulated in the CFs and specifically expressed in interstitial fibrosis of hypertensive DS rat hearts.
